Turandot (2013) offers a unique take on Puccini's last opera, diving into the dark psyche of a cruel princess. The atmosphere is heavy with tension, perfectly reflecting the stakes of life and death tied to her riddles. The pacing feels both deliberate and urgent, capturing the weight of each suitor's fate. Musically, it's lush and haunting, a testament to Puccini's genius, and the vocal performances are bold, with moments that really showcase the emotional turmoil. The production design leans towards opulent, which contrasts starkly with the grim narrative. There's something distinctly captivating about how the story grapples with themes of power, vengeance, and the complexities of love, making it a fascinating piece for anyone who appreciates opera on film.
